Yet another good performance for the non-stop runner, Antonio Candreva, a key player in Inter’s 2-1 win away to Brescia. The Nerazzurri wing-back recorded his 100th Serie A appearance for Inter tonight.
This is what Candreva had to say after the win:
“It’s a great honor for me, I’m happy to celebrate it with a win. We had to get rid of the sour taste after that draw against Parma, today we’re bringing home three big points.”
“This was our fourth game in just a matter of days so there was a bit of fatigue on show. It was important to get right back to it, but we have to turn our thoughts to Bologna immediately, and to the Champions League after that: they’re all important games.”
